Value for airline customers

FlytEDGE features the Crystal Cabin® award-winning Onboard Data Center (ODC) with 96TB of storage to enable on-board edge caching, this solution reduces connectivity consumption and ensures bandwidth is available for other inflight services. No matter how many people watch the same content, each title streams once to the aircraft allowing passengers to instantly access endless entertainment.

The ODC takes the IFE system performance to new heights.

  • Replaces the traditional multi-server network with an effective and compact blade architecture
  • Simplifies upgradeability path with easy blade swaps
  • Ensures the highest system availability

About Thales

Thales (Euronext Paris: HO) is a global leader in advanced technologies within three domains: Defence & Security, Aeronautics & Space, and Cybersecurity and Digital Identity. It develops products and solutions that help make the world safer, greener and more inclusive.

The Group invests close to €4 billion a year in Research & Development, particularly in key innovation areas such as AI, cybersecurity, quantum technologies, cloud technologies and 6G.

Thales has 81,000* employees in 68 countries. In 2023, the Group generated sales of €18.4 billion.

* These figures exclude the ground transportation business, which is being divested
